Does Intermittent Fasting Cause Muscle Loss?


 If you've considered intermittent fasting but lift weights, train regularly, or simply want to preserve muscle while losing fat, you've probably run into a persistent concern: does fasting cause muscle loss?

It's a valid question. Muscle tissue is metabolically active and valuable for long-term health, strength, and metabolism, so protecting it is a reasonable priority. The good news is that intermittent fasting itself is not inherently a major driver of muscle loss but certain mistakes commonly made while fasting can absolutely put muscle at risk. Understanding the difference is key.

The Short Answer

Research suggests that when total daily protein intake and calories are adequate, and resistance training is maintained, intermittent fasting does not appear to cause significantly more muscle loss compared to traditional calorie restriction spread throughout the day. The real risk factors for muscle loss during fasting are usually related to how fasting is implemented, not the practice of fasting itself.


How Muscle Loss Actually Happens

To understand whether fasting causes muscle loss, it helps to understand the basic mechanism. Muscle tissue is maintained through a balance between:

  • Muscle protein synthesis — The process of building and repairing muscle tissue
  • Muscle protein breakdown — The natural process of breaking down muscle tissue for various bodily functions

When protein synthesis meets or exceeds protein breakdown over time, muscle is maintained or built. When breakdown consistently exceeds synthesis often due to insufficient protein intake, inadequate calories, or lack of resistance training muscle loss occurs.

Fasting windows do not automatically shift this balance dramatically, as long as total daily protein intake remains sufficient.

Why the "Fasting Causes Muscle Loss" Myth Persists

1. Confusion Between Short-Term Fasting and Starvation

Prolonged, severe caloric restriction (true starvation) does cause significant muscle loss over time. However, typical intermittent fasting protocols like 16:8 involve daily refeeding periods, which is fundamentally different from prolonged starvation.

2. Misunderstanding of "Catabolic State"

Some believe the body immediately shifts into a muscle-wasting "catabolic state" the moment you stop eating. In reality, the body has stored glycogen and fat reserves that are used for energy well before muscle tissue becomes a significant energy source, particularly during fasting windows of 24 hours or less.

3. Overlooking Total Daily Protein Intake

The research is fairly consistent that total daily protein intake not meal timing or frequency is one of the strongest predictors of muscle preservation, especially when combined with resistance training.


What Actually Puts Muscle at Risk During Fasting

1. Insufficient Total Protein Intake

If your compressed eating window makes it difficult to consume adequate protein generally recommended around 1.6–2.2 grams per kilogram of bodyweight for those trying to preserve or build muscle this is one of the most significant risk factors for muscle loss.

2. Excessive Calorie Deficit

A very large calorie deficit, regardless of whether it's achieved through fasting or traditional dieting, increases the risk of muscle loss alongside fat loss. Moderate, sustainable deficits are generally better for muscle preservation.

3. Lack of Resistance Training

Without a stimulus to maintain muscle such as regular resistance or strength training the body has less reason to prioritize preserving muscle tissue during a calorie deficit, regardless of fasting schedule.

4. Very Long Fasting Windows Without Adequate Refeeding

Extended fasts (24 hours or longer) done frequently, without sufficient calorie and protein intake during refeeding periods, may increase the risk of muscle loss compared to more moderate daily fasting windows like 16:8.


How to Protect Muscle While Practicing Intermittent Fasting

1. Prioritize Total Daily Protein Intake

Make sure your protein target is met within your eating window, even if it means planning meals more deliberately. Distributing protein across two to three meals within your window is generally effective.

2. Continue Resistance Training

Regular strength training remains one of the most powerful signals to the body to preserve and even build muscle tissue, regardless of your eating schedule.

3. Avoid Excessively Large Calorie Deficits

A moderate calorie deficit (typically around 15–25% below maintenance) tends to support fat loss while better preserving muscle mass compared to more extreme deficits.

4. Time Your Largest Meal Around Training

Eating a substantial, protein-rich meal before or after your workout can help support muscle repair and recovery, regardless of whether you're training fasted or fed.


5. Consider a Slightly Longer Eating Window If Needed

If you're struggling to consume adequate protein and calories within a very short eating window (such as 16:8), extending it slightly (to 14:10 or 12:12) may make it easier to meet your nutritional needs while still enjoying the benefits of a defined eating pattern.

6. Monitor Progress Beyond the Scale

Tracking strength performance, how clothes fit, and progress photos can offer a more complete picture of whether you're maintaining muscle, rather than relying on scale weight alone, which doesn't distinguish between fat and muscle loss.


What the Research Generally Shows

Several studies comparing intermittent fasting to traditional calorie restriction, when protein intake is matched, have found comparable outcomes in terms of muscle preservation. Some research even suggests that when combined with resistance training, individuals practicing intermittent fasting can maintain or in some cases build muscle while losing fat, similar to those following more traditional structured eating patterns.

This reinforces the idea that muscle preservation depends far more on total protein intake, resistance training, and the size of the calorie deficit than on the specific timing of meals.

Final Thoughts

Intermittent fasting, on its own, is not a major direct cause of muscle loss. The real risk factors inadequate protein intake, excessive calorie deficits, lack of resistance training, and very long fasting windows without proper refeeding are things that can happen with or without fasting, and can be effectively managed with the right approach.

If preserving or building muscle is a priority, focus on hitting your daily protein target, maintaining a consistent resistance training routine, and avoiding overly aggressive calorie deficits. With these fundamentals in place, intermittent fasting can be a perfectly compatible approach alongside your muscle-building or muscle-preserving goals.
